A circuit board, frequently referred to as a PCB board or printed circuit card, is an essential element in electronic devices. It offers as a structure for installing and adjoining digital parts via conductive paths engraved from copper sheets. PCBs are important to the performance of electronic gadgets, enabling the effective flow of electrical energy between elements. Among the variations of PCBs, the flexible printed circuit board, additionally recognized by its acronym, flex PCB, sticks out for its adaptability and versatility. These flexible circuits are made from products like polyimide or polyester, which permit them to flex and flex without damaging. This capability is important in applications where space is minimal or where the board requires to fit right into unique shapes. As an example, in customer electronic devices, automobile, and medical tools, flex PCBs are commonly utilized to make sure reputable connections regardless of the architectural difficulties of the housing layout.

Heading towards a somewhat extra complex framework, rigid-flex PCBs incorporate the benefits of rigid and flexible circuit boards into a solitary composite board. They open new style opportunities and are utilized in applications that require both longevity and versatility. Rigid-flex PCBs can endure mechanical stress better while keeping the electric stability essential for high-performance gadgets. They are regularly used in armed forces, aerospace, and instrumentation fields where area optimization and integrity are crucial. Flex PCBs, as a result of their unique develop, require specific fabrication techniques. Flex PCB fabrication involves creating the flexible base layer, including conductive traces, and then do with protective layers to protect against environmental variables.
